Buick has long been known for producing reliable and comfortable vehicles. In recent years, the brand has also focused on fuel efficiency, offering models that save money at the pump while providing a smooth driving experience. Here are the top 10 Buick vehicles with the highest miles per gallon (MPG), helping you make an eco-friendly choice without sacrificing quality.
1. Buick Encore GX
The Buick Encore GX is a compact SUV that offers impressive fuel economy. It achieves up to 30 MPG city and 32 MPG highway, making it a popular choice for city driving and long trips alike. Its efficient turbocharged engine provides a good balance of power and economy.
2. Buick Encore
The smaller Buick Encore is known for its agility and fuel efficiency. It delivers around 25 MPG city and 30 MPG highway. Its compact size makes it ideal for urban environments and parking in tight spots.
3. Buick LaCrosse (2019 and newer)
The Buick LaCrosse, especially the 2019 models and later, offers a refined ride with excellent fuel economy. It provides up to 25 MPG city and 36 MPG highway, thanks to its efficient V6 engine and aerodynamic design.
4. Buick Regal TourX
The Regal TourX combines wagon versatility with fuel efficiency, achieving approximately 22 MPG city and 29 MPG highway. Its spacious interior and smooth handling make it a practical choice for families.
5. Buick Envision
The Buick Envision is a midsize SUV that balances comfort and economy. It offers up to 22 MPG city and 29 MPG highway. Its turbocharged engine helps maximize fuel savings on daily commutes.
6. Buick Cascada (discontinued but efficient)
The Buick Cascada convertible, though discontinued, was known for its stylish design and good fuel economy, with around 20 MPG city and 28 MPG highway. It remains a fun, efficient option in used car markets.
7. Buick Enclave (recent models)
The Buick Enclave offers a spacious interior with respectable fuel economy. It reaches up to 18 MPG city and 26 MPG highway. Its V6 engine provides power while maintaining decent efficiency.
8. Buick Skylark (classic models)
Although no longer in production, classic Buick Skylarks are noted for their durability and, in some models, surprisingly good fuel economy for their era. They can achieve around 20 MPG depending on the engine and condition.
9. Buick Excelle
The Buick Excelle, popular in international markets, is known for its compact size and efficiency. It typically offers around 28 MPG combined, making it an economical choice for daily commuting.
10. Buick Regal (older models)
Older Buick Regal models are appreciated for their balance of performance and fuel economy. They can provide up to 22 MPG city and 32 MPG highway, especially with the turbocharged engines.
